以太坊keystore是什麼
Ⅰ keystore是什麼,unity3d直接打包出來的apk中如何修改它
根據你的描述:
keystore是簽名。
原來用Eclipse開發android時候打包的時候需要簽名,這個簽名是記錄開發者以及開發公司產品信息等等!但是最近學習unity時看到打包可以選擇不簽名的!修改和創建的話網路一下就知道了。
Ⅱ keystore路徑是什麼意思直白的告訴我好么 我是文盲
你用Android studio或其他IDE寫的應用,可以生成一個KeyStore文件,加固讓你填的KeyStore路徑就是你自己生成這個文件的路徑。
Ⅲ java中的keystore具體是什麼東西,怎麼個用法。
數字簽名,是用於客戶端驗證的,如果你的應用需要訪問客戶機資源,這個就是一個沖出沙箱的操作,客戶端會在載入你的應用時自動下載你提供的證書,當應用需要訪問客戶機資源時,他會用證書里的指紋和你提供功能包進行匹配,只有指紋相同,才能訪問客戶機資源。
Ⅳ Android打包時keystore和key有什麼區別
APK簽名用處主要有兩種
1. 使用特殊的key簽名可以獲取到一些不同的許可權。
2. APK如果使用一個key簽名,發布時另一個key簽名的文件將無法安裝或覆蓋老的版本,這樣可以防止你已安裝的應用被惡意的第三方覆蓋或替換掉
生成方法:
dos下進入JDK的bin目錄,運行如下命令:
keytool -genkey -alias android.keystore -keyalg RSA -validity 20000 -keystore android.keystore
(-validity 20000代表有效期天數),命令完成後,bin目錄中會生成android.keystore
如何查看呢?看命令
keytool -list -keystore "android.keystore" 輸入你設置的keystore密碼即可
獲取SHA1密文和MD5密文
說明:google map v1介面申請apikey的時候需要MD5,而v2介面需要SHA1密文
獲取密文都需要android 的app.keystore即打包時候用的密鑰
在eclipse 開發的時候默認的會用eclipse生成的debug.keystore
我們以debug.keystore為例生成SHA1 和MD5
請按照如下步驟執行
1,首先要找到eclipse的debug.keystore文件所在目錄
默認情況下它和虛擬機AVD存放在一起,win7下的路徑是:C:\Users\your_user_name\.android\,也可以通過Eclipse中的Windows > Prefs > Android > Build來查看這個路徑。
文件名叫debug.keystore。
然後,用keytool 獲取SHA1和MD5
1,keytool工具是JDK自帶的工具,安裝了JDK之後,找到安裝目錄keytool就在jdk的bin目錄下,
我的jdk目錄是C:\Program Files\Java\jdk1.6.0_21\bin
2,在cmd命令行里運行下列命令:
keytool -list -v -keystore "C:\Users\your_user_name\.android\debug.keystore" -alias android
就顯示一大堆東西,其中就有證書指紋:
SHA1和MD5
這里說明一下:上面的
」C:\Users\your_user_name\.android\debug.keystore「就是我的debug.keystore的所在位置
Ⅳ KEYSTORE_ABE_KEY是什麼意思
KEYSTORE_ABE_KEY中文翻譯的意思是:密鑰庫
Ⅵ php如何通過keystore獲取到私鑰(以太坊)
以太坊源碼go-ethereum怎麼運行
安裝基於MIPS的linux頭文件
$ cd $PRJROOT/kernel
$ tar -xjvf linux-2.6.38.tar.bz2
$ cd linux-2.6.38
在指定路徑下創建include文件夾,用來存放相關頭文件。
$ mkdir -p $TARGET_PREFIX/include
保證linux源碼是干凈的。
$ make mrproper
生成需要的頭自文件。
$ make ARCH=mips headers_check
$ make ARCH=mips INSTALL_HDR_PATH=dest headers_install
將dest文件夾下的所有文件復制到指定的include文件夾內。zd
$ cp -rv dest/include/* $TARGET_PREFIX/include
最後刪除dest文件夾
$ rm -rf dest
$ ls -l $TARGET_PREFIX/include
Ⅶ keystore是怎麼生成的
生成android的keystore文件有以下兩種方法:一、eclipse 中生成android keystore1、建立任意一個android項目(例如:AntForAndroid)2、右鍵AntForAndroid根目錄彈出菜單->Android Tools -> Export Signed Application Package->Next >3、創建密鑰庫keystore,輸入密鑰庫導出位置和密碼,記住密碼,下次Use existing keystore會用到4、選擇「Create new keystore」並且保存在項目跟目錄下,輸入密碼,然後next5、填寫密鑰庫信息,填寫一些apk文件的密碼,使用期限和組織單位的信息。填寫的Alias 和 密碼不要忘記了6、生成帶簽名的apk文件,到此就結束了。7、如果下次發布版本的時候,使用前面生成的keystore再簽名。這樣在項目根目錄下就生成以上流程產生的androids.keystore了二、命令行生成keystoredos下進入JDK的bin目錄運行如下命令:keytool -genkey -alias android.keystore -keyalg RSA -validity 20000 -keystore android.keystore(-validity 20000代表有效期天數),命令完成後,bin目錄中會生成android.keystore查看命令keytool -list -keystore "android.keystore" 輸入設置的keystore密碼
Ⅷ 如何解析以太坊的keystore文件
t you," the matron said, "
Ⅸ android 應用的keystore有什麼用
是java的密鑰庫、用來進行通信加密用的、比如數字簽名。keystore就是用來保存密鑰對的,比如公鑰和私鑰。通俗的將,這個東西建立了開發者與app的聯系,你是它的締造者,所以擁有對這個apk的絕對控制權。我們通常可以通過這個秘鑰做到:
1. 使用特殊的key簽名可以獲取到一些不同的許可權。
2. APK如果使用一個key簽名,發布時另一個key簽名的文件將無法安裝或覆蓋老的版本,這樣可以防止你已安裝的應用被惡意的第三方覆蓋或替換掉
